This 10 month program derived the conceptual design of a small diameter, shoulder launched, direct fire missile for use as a guidance test bed. The resulting design is practical, versatile, and modular, and can exercise a variety of present and advanced technology seekers over a broad range regime. Although the missile makes maximum use of off-the-shelf components and is well within existing technology capabilities, its accuracy potential is sufficient for any anticipated guidance system.
